An avarage induced e.m.f. of 1 V appears in a coil when the current in it is changed from 10 A in one direction to 10A in opposite direction in 0.5 sec. Self inductance of the coil is

Options

(a) 50 mH
(b) 25 mH
(c) 100 mH
(d) 75 mH

Correct Answer:

25 mH
